Table Tents

The table tent is probably what customers are most familiar with. These promotional vehicles normally reside in the middle of the table neighboring the salt, pepper and sugar. This is an ideal location to grab your patron’s attention before they order. It’s a beautiful spot for advertising additional concepts as well.

Posters & Banners

What better spot to grab your customers’ attention than when they first walk in the door? After the proper host says “right this way,” they see a magnificent and mouth-watering display of your prized product. This also lays down the proper foundation and readies them for more information supplied at the table. Menu

The menu is the final resting spot where your patron’s decisions are bouncing back and forth. What makes them point to their final choice? Positioning the items in a proper manner allows the customer to easily navigate through and get what they want. This placement allows them to easily digest what will be soon digested.
